Used in place of DIP switches for configuration of the work and electrode sense
leads
"Positive" (default) = Most GMAW welding procedures use Electrode
Positive welding.
"Negative" = Most GTAW and some inner shield procedures use Electrode
Negative welding.
Uses for calibration and tests.
"No" (factory default) = Turned off;
"Yes" = Allows to selection test modes.
Note: After the device has been restarted the P.99 is "NO".
This parameter is active only when the USB Memory Stick (with upgrade file) is
connected to USB socket.
